Summary of Key Points from Conference Call Industry Overview - The global technology sector is experiencing a significant downturn, influenced by various macroeconomic factors and industry-specific challenges [1][2][3]. Core Insights and Arguments 1. **Monetary Policy Outlook**: The Federal Reserve is expected to maintain a passive easing monetary policy until mid-2026, with potential interest rate cuts of 25 basis points in December [1][3]. 2. **Long-term Investment in Tech**: Domestic long-term funds have significantly increased their positions in technology stocks during the recent market adjustment, particularly in the robotics sector, anticipating a bullish trend before the 2026 Spring Festival [1][4]. 3. **AR Market Dynamics**: The global AR competitive landscape is shifting from a dominance of OpenAI to a multi-tiered competition, benefiting companies like Nvidia and domestic AR firms, suggesting long-term investment opportunities [1][5]. 4. **Performance Disparity**: Recent market performance has shown a clear divide, with companies closely associated with OpenAI, such as Microsoft and Nvidia, performing better than those entirely reliant on OpenAI [1][7]. 5. **AI Industry Development**: The AI sector continues to evolve, with high evaluations for new models like Gemini 3 and Grok 4.1, while OpenAI faces challenges including financial pressure and declining market share [1][8][9]. 6. **OpenAI's Challenges**: OpenAI is experiencing significant challenges, including reduced user engagement and a drop in market share from 80% to 66%, indicating potential issues with its business model [1][9][10]. 7. **Impact of OpenAI's Developments**: OpenAI's recent developments have caused short-term volatility in the tech stock market, but the long-term outlook remains positive due to the emergence of multi-company competition [1][11]. 8. **Regulatory Challenges**: OpenAI's operations are constrained by strict regulations, particularly from left-leaning political forces, which could hinder its growth and innovation [1][12][13]. 9. **Market Trends**: The global AI market is transitioning from OpenAI's dominance to a more competitive environment, with its market share potentially dropping to 50% while competitors like Google and X.AI gain ground [1][14][15]. 10. **Investment Recommendations**: Investors are advised to focus on sectors such as robotics and brokerage firms, while also considering the implications of upcoming economic policies [1][17][18]. Additional Important Insights - **Domestic Fund Flows**: Recent inflows into domestic indices like the CSI 300 and Shanghai Composite indicate strong support for the market, with significant capital inflow of nearly 25 billion [1][16]. - **Market Sentiment**: The current market sentiment reflects a cautious approach from institutional investors, with expectations of a potential rebound in tech stocks as the year progresses [1][19][20]. - **Future Investment Strategies**: Investors should consider a balanced asset allocation strategy, focusing on technology leaders and sectors poised for growth, while being mindful of market volatility [1][22].
